Requires entities to remove abandoned lines and mark information on certain lines.
This bill requires companies and organizations that own telecommunications or cable television lines (like phone or internet providers) to remove lines that are no longer in use or unsafe. Specifically, it mandates removal of "abandoned" lines (those not maintained, not in operation for 24+ months, or requested for removal by property owners) and requires new lines to be marked with the owner's identifying information. Property owners and others can request removal of suspected abandoned lines through a formal process involving the Board of Public Utilities. The law applies to all entities owning such lines in New Jersey, aiming to improve safety and clarity around infrastructure.
